Clinical, Enamel, and Radiographic Features of Amelogenesis Imperfecta in Pediatric Patients: A Multicenter Study

This study aimed to characterize the clinical, enamel, and radiographic features of amelogenesis imperfecta (AI) in pediatric patients in Korea and to compare these features across AI phenotypes. This multicenter retrospective study reviewed records of 39 patients aged < 18 years who were diagnosed with AI across 11 university dental hospitals between 2022 and 2025. The patients were classified into hypoplastic, hypomaturation, and hypocalcified phenotypes according to the Witkop classification. The clinical, enamel, and radiographic variables were collected using a standardized electronic case report form, and the differences among the phenotypic groups were analyzed using the Monte Carlo version of Fisher’s exact test. The hypoplastic phenotype was the most prevalent (53.8%), followed by hypomaturation (28.2%) and hypocalcified (17.9%). The mean age at first dental visit was 9.62 ± 3.48 years, with most patients presenting during the mixed or permanent dentition stage. Hypersensitivity, periodontal disease, and crossbite differed significantly by phenotype and were most frequent in the hypocalcified group. The hypoplastic group most frequently showed white-yellow discoloration, pitting, and reduced radiographic enamel thickness, whereas the hypocalcified group showed yellow-brown discoloration, enamel wear, and decreased radiopacity in all cases. Taurodontism was the most frequently identified radiographic anomaly. This multicenter cohort study suggests phenotype-related differences in the clinical manifestations of AI and provides baseline clinical information that may support earlier diagnosis and inform phenotype-based multidisciplinary management in pediatric patients.
